Rising Demand for Investment Castings in Renewable Energy Sector

2025-04-28

As the global push toward clean energy accelerates, investment castings have emerged as a critical technology for the renewable energy sector. Components like wind turbine blades, solar panel brackets, and hydropower housings demand high precision, excellent corrosion resistance, and complex geometries -- all strengths of investment casting.

Recent industry reports show that the investment casting market in renewables is projected to grow at a CAGR of 7.5% through 2029. Stainless steels, nickel-based superalloys, and lightweight aluminum alloys dominate material selection.

Key drivers of demand include:

The shift to offshore wind farms, where durability is paramount.
Grid modernization projects requiring high-efficiency components.
Advances in energy storage and hydrogen fuel systems.
Investment casting not only allows for the production of highly engineered shapes but also supports net-shape manufacturing, reducing the need for secondary machining and material waste.
Manufacturers with expertise in casting complex, thin-walled parts and who can adapt to green material standards are best positioned to thrive. As governments worldwide increase their investments in renewables, demand for precision-cast components will only accelerate.
